EXTERIOR AND INTERIOR LIGHTS
Item Wattage (W) Bulb No.*
Headlight assembly
Low (Halogen) 55 H1
Low (Xenon) (special) D2R
High 60 HB3 (9005)
Park/Turn/Sidemarker 27/8 1157
Front fog light 55 HB4 (9006)
Step light — 158
Rear combination light
Tail/Stop 27/8 3157
Turn 27 3156
Backup (reversing) 13 912
Sidemarker 5 168
License plate light 5 168
High-mounted stop light
Inside 18 921
Spoiler (if so equipped)See a NISSAN dealer
for assistance
Interior light 8 68
Map light 10 578
Trunk light 3.4 158
Glove box light (if so equipped) 3.4 658
*: Always check with the Parts Department at a NISSAN dealer for the latest parts information.
